WebCrockery can be recycled, but not in residential recycle bins. Most councils accept ceramic plates, bowls and other crockery at HWRC’s (aka tips or dumps), commonly in the rubble … WebDec 20, 2024 · Can you put crockery in the recycle bin? No, you can not put crockery in the recycle bin. Crockery basically refers to any ceramic items in your kitchen, like plates or mugs. Ceramic is not a recyclable material, so you will need to find another method to … By putting porcelain in a recycling bin, it can contaminate recyclable glass. ... Rigid plastic (washed and dry): plastic drink bottles, plastic cleaning bottles ... client services specialist iiWebCookware, Crockery and Cutlery Recycling Information. Broken crockery can be disposed of in the red lidded garbage bin. However if it's in good condition, it may be accepted at local charities. Before you drop off your items, call ahead to ensure that your pre-loved items will be accepted.
